Alex is tracking how many computers he can fix in an afternoon. He listed the number of computers fixed per hour in the following table:

Hour (x) Number of Customers f(x)

1 4

2 8

3 12

Determine if these data represent a linear function or an exponential function, and give the common difference or ratio.


This is an exponential function because there is a common ratio of 4.


This is a linear function because there is a common difference of 4.


This is a linear function because there is a common difference of 8.


This is an exponential function because there is a common ratio of 8.

Answer:

This is a linear function because there is a common difference of 4

⇒ 2nd answer

Explanation:

- In the linear function there is a common difference between each two

consecutive data

- In the exponential function there is a common ratio between each two

consecutive data

- Lats check the data in the data in the table

(x) === 1 ⇒ 2 ⇒ 3

f(x) === 4 ⇒ 8 ⇒ 12

∵ x has consecutive numbers 1 , 2 , 3

∵ 8 - 4 = 4

∵ 12 - 8 = 4

∴ f(x) has a common difference 4

∵ 8 ÷ 4 = 2

∵ 12 ÷ 8 = 1.5

∴ f(x) has no common ratio

∴ The table represents a linear function with common difference 4

This is a linear function because there is a common difference of 4
